KNOXVILLE, Tenn. (AP) The daughter of former SEC Commissioner Roy Kramer has been hired by Tennessee as assistant ticket director for men's and women's sports.<br>
<br>
Sara Gray Kramer arrived this week from her alma mater, Central Michigan University, where she was assistant director of athletic development and ticket manager, Tennessee announced Thursday.<br>
<br>
``I'm not into conspiracies, I'm into hiring the best people,'' Tennessee athletic director Mike Hamilton said.<br>
<br>
Kramer will oversee women's basketball tickets, customer service and all daily ticket office operations at Tennessee.<br>
<br>
``We're thrilled that Sara Gray has joined our team,'' said Chris Besanceney, assistant athletic director for ticketing. ``Her knowledge and experience will be beneficial for us here at Tennessee.''<br>
<br>
Roy Kramer, a native of nearby Maryville, retired as SEC commissioner in 2002 and now lives in a golf resort community south of Knoxville.<br>
